Output 32bec74241f06e15770968585029a914d22bf118acf3ed0104e41be1bc438a14:1

value
1652605
script pubkey
OP_0 OP_PUSHBYTES_20 eebfdcf9a925ff9a7a47e2995d3fc24d25deb4fb
address
bc1qa6lae7dfyhle57j8u2v4607zf5jaad8m2qwqde
transaction
32bec74241f06e15770968585029a914d22bf118acf3ed0104e41be1bc438a14